Installers in Alexandria, VA Virginia 22304

Leidos Inc
2111 Eisenhower Avenue # 205, Alexandria, VA
Professional, Scientific, and Technical Services

Continuum Energy Solution
5645 General Washington Drive # D, Alexandria, VA
Other Services (except Public Administration)

Development Resources Inc
1421 Prince St, Alexandria, VA
Professional, Scientific, and Technical Services

Washington Energy Systems Home
4813b Eisenhower Avenue, Alexandria, VA
Professional, Scientific, and Technical Services